The cheapest way to get from Lille to Bedford is to train via London which costs £50 - £110 and takes 2h 44m.
The fastest way to get from Lille to Bedford is to train which takes 2h 9m and costs £95 - £180.
No, there is no direct train from Lille to Bedford. However, there are services departing from Lille Europe and arriving at Bedford via London St Pancras Intl.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 2h 9m.
The distance between Lille and Bedford is 216 miles.
The best way to get from Lille to Bedford without a car is to train which takes 2h 9m and costs £95 - £180.
It takes approximately 2h 9m to get from Lille to Bedford, including transfers.
